CR3

CR3 is Canon’s newer RAW image format used by modern Canon cameras to preserve high-detail original sensor information. It is best for current Canon photography workflows where editing flexibility and image quality are priorities.

MIME Type:

image/cr3

Common Uses:

Modern Canon RAW photography, Advanced photo editing, High-quality original capture storage

Advantages:

  • Supports rich original image data
  • Useful for modern Canon post-processing workflows
  • Good for non-destructive editing and archival use

Disadvantages:

  • Needs compatible software and newer tool support
  • Large files are less convenient than delivery-ready formats

PBM

PBM is a simple portable bitmap format used for black-and-white raster images in the Netpbm family. It is most useful for basic monochrome image processing, command-line utilities, and educational or low-level graphics workflows.

MIME Type:

image/x-portable-bitmap

Common Uses:

Monochrome bitmap images, Netpbm tool workflows, Simple image processing tasks

Advantages:

  • Extremely simple format structure
  • Easy to parse in scripts and utilities
  • Useful for low-level image experimentation

Disadvantages:

  • Only supports basic black-and-white imagery
  • Not practical for modern consumer image needs
